1. What is the best time to visit Budapest?

Budapest has a continental climate with four distinct seasons. The best time to visit Budapest is during the shoulder months of spring (March-April) and autumn (September-October). During these months, the weather is mild and pleasant, and the crowds are smaller than in the peak summer season. However, if you want to experience Budapest’s lively outdoor events and festivals, then the summer months (June-August) are the best time to visit.

2. What is the currency used in Budapest?

The official currency of Hungary is the Hungarian Forint (HUF). The exchange rate varies from time to time, so it’s best to check the current exchange rate before traveling to Budapest. Most shops, restaurants, and tourist attractions in Budapest accept major credit and debit cards, but it’s always a good idea to carry some cash with you.

3. Do people in Budapest speak English?

English is not the official language of Hungary, but it is widely spoken in Budapest. Most people who work in tourism-related industries speak English, and there are many signs and menus in English. However, it’s polite to learn a few basic phrases in Hungarian, such as “hello” (szia), “thank you” (köszönöm), and “goodbye” (viszlát).

4. Is Budapest a safe city?

Budapest is a relatively safe city, but like any other big city, it’s important to take precautions to avoid theft and other crimes. It’s best to avoid walking alone at night, especially in less-visited neighborhoods. Keep an eye on your belongings and use common sense when traveling on public transport.

5. What are the must-see attractions in Budapest?

Budapest is a city full of beautiful buildings, museums, and parks. Some of the must-see attractions include:

– Buda Castle: a historic castle complex with stunning views of the city.
– Fisherman’s Bastion: a neo-Gothic terrace that offers panoramic views of Budapest.
– Hungarian Parliament Building: a magnificent example of neo-Gothic architecture.
– Széchenyi Thermal Baths: one of the largest and most famous thermal baths in Budapest.
– St. Stephen’s Basilica: a majestic Catholic cathedral with a panoramic view from its dome.

6. How do I get around in Budapest?

Budapest has an extensive public transportation system, including buses, trams, and metro lines. You can purchase tickets from vending machines at most metro stations or from newsstands. Taxis are also widely available, but it’s best to use licensed taxis or ride-sharing apps to avoid scams.

7. What is Hungarian cuisine like?

Hungarian cuisine is hearty, flavorful, and often includes meat, potatoes, and paprika. Some of the must-try dishes in Budapest include:

– Goulash: a beef stew with paprika and vegetables.
– Langos: a deep-fried dough topped with sour cream, cheese, and garlic.
– Chimney cake: a sweet pastry made of rolled dough, sugar, and cinnamon.
– Hungarian sausage: a spicy sausage made of pork or beef.
